DISINFO: 90% of Europeans are convinced that Ukraine lost the war
SUMMARY
Ukraine lost the conflict, and 90% of Europeans are convinced of it. However, on Capitol Hill and in Hollywood, they stubbornly deny reality.
RESPONSE
Misinterpretation of a public opinion poll, promoting a narrative that Ukraine lost and Russia won the conflict. This manipulative presentation is designed to erode public support for Ukraine's cause which is especially promoted during the run-up to European Parliament elections 6-9 June 2024.
It is true that a poll gave the picture of European citizens pessimistic about the outcome of the conflict:
An average of just 10 per cent of Europeans across 12 countries believe that Ukraine will win. Twice as many expect a Russian victory. We can only speculate as to how people define a Russian victory, but it seems plausible to suggest that, for many, the idea of a Russian victory means Ukraine will not be able to liberate all its occupied territories (and a Ukrainian victory that it will).
While 10% of people expect a Ukrainian victory, the text clearly states that only 20% expect a defeat of Ukraine.
